The Overall Health Score in 93308, Bakersfield, California is 27 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
80.18 percent of the population in 93308 drive to work alone. 1.02 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 77.32 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 5.76 percent of the residents in 93308 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.60 members with about 1.94 cars available per household.
An estimate of 90.66 percent of the residents in 93308 has some form of health insurance. 51.39 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 49.49 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 93308 would have to travel an average of 2.89 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Bakersfield Heart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 1,776 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 93308, Bakersfield, California.

As of , an estimate of 54,857 residents live in 93308 with a median age of 35.7 years. 26.20 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 13.73 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 35.04 percent of the residents in 93308 is currently married, and 24.77 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 93308 is $4,945.00.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 93308 is approximately $1,100. The median household spends about 22.24 percent of their income on housing.

The history of Bakersfield is rich and diverse, with roots stretching back to the indigenous peoples and a later boom thanks to oil discovery in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. This heritage has cultivated a community spirit that is reflected in its commitment to providing healthcare services that cater to its diverse population. Modern-day Bakersfield continues to grow as a hub for both agriculture and energy production, which has led to an increased demand for comprehensive healthcare options.
In 93308, residents have access to several healthcare facilities that provide a range of services from routine check-ups to specialized medical treatments. At the core is Adventist Health Bakersfield, which serves as one of the primary hospitals offering emergency services, maternity care, cancer treatment, and more. This hospital's reputation for quality care is well-known in the region and it stands as a cornerstone of health services for locals.
